titleOfInvention Manufacture process for eucalyptus core plate
abstract The invention discloses a manufacture process for a eucalyptus core plate. The manufacture process comprises the following steps of: drying, groove planing, material cutting, plate joining, primary sanding, assembly, cold pressing, repairing, primary heat pressing, ash scraping, secondary sanding, surfacing, secondary heat pressing, edge sawing, polishing, inspecting, putting in storage and the like. The manufactured eucalyptus core plate has the advantages of good quality, attractive patterns on an edge, a smooth plate surface, large density, heavy weight, sensibility of thickness, easiness in processing, excellent nail holding force, non-deformation and the like. According to the manufacture process, core bars inside the eucalyptus are recycled and processed to form a eucalyptus core plate, thus the energy is saved, the cost is lowered, and the manufactured eucalyptus core plate can be applied in various fields of furniture industry.
